What is recorded here
The National Monuments Record of Wales records Redstone Cross Barrows as Round Barrow from the Unknown period. The saved point comes from the official national record. Inclusion does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.
Round barrow, likely dating to the Early Bronze Age. Its significance lies in contributing to the understanding of burial practices and landscape use during this period in Wales.
